从接口到落地:IM钱包深度接入与私密支付实战教程

引导语:本教程面向工程与产品团队,逐步讲解如何把IM钱包接口变成可生产的私密支付系统,兼顾安全、合规与创新落地。

1. 接口概述与设计要点

说明REST/WebSocket双通道,建议统一鉴权层:客户端用JWT短时令牌,服务端用HMAC-SHA256签名验证请求体与nonce,同时启用webhook异步通知,保证幂等(idempotency_key)。

2. 智能支付验证实现

实现流程:生成订单→签名请求→链下风控(规则引擎/https://www.aishibao.net ,模型)→上链广播。风控建议引入行为指纹与阈值验证,失败策略可回滚或二次验证(短信/生物)。在关键点记录不可篡改日志以便审计。

3. 加密货币支付接入

多链抽象:封装转账、签名、费用估算接口;私钥管理使用HSM或MPC阈签,离线签名与事务池监控并实现重放防护。建议实现费率动态调节、UTXO聚合与分拆策略以优化手续费与隐私。

4. 市场预测与灵活资产配置

接入可靠预言机(如Chainlink)与自研因子模型,周期性再平衡策略可根据波动率、流动性和手续费实时调整持仓比。提供模拟回测与沙盒环境以检验配置策略。

5. 私密身份保护与私密身份验证

采用DID与零知识证明(ZK)组合:用DID管理可撤销凭证,用ZK-SNARK/PLONK在验证资格时不泄露敏感信息。移动端优先使用TEE/安全元件存储密钥,服务端最小化持有可识别数据。

6. 创新趋势与工程实践

关注可组合的模块化钱包、阈签+多签混合方案、链下支付通道与原生可替代隐私层(例如隐私代币或zk-rollup)。持续做渗透测试、合规审计并设计回退与升级路径。

结束语:把接口做成产品,不只是代码:要在鉴权、签名、风控、预言机与隐私验证间找到工程与政策的平衡。按上述步骤搭建可扩展的IM钱包接入框架,既能满足当下支付需求,也为未来创新留出空间。

作者:林晓辰发布时间:2025-08-26 00:21:34

相关阅读